как сделать книгу активной в vba

 

 

 

 

Нужен макрос для Excel? Сделайте заказ прямо сейчас!Главная » Макросы VBA Excel. Выбор другой открытой книги для получения данных. Нижеследующий код позволяет создать новую книгу Excel из листов текущей книги, содержащей макросы.Полезные ссылки. Как средствами VBA переименовать/переместить/скопировать файл. Форум - VBA.Активирует книгу если открыта (без заморочек), открывает книгу если не открыта и выдает диалоговое окно -. файл c.xls уже открыт, повторное открытие приведет к потере выполненных изменений. VBA работает, выполняя макросы, пошаговые процедуры, написанные на языке Visual Basic.Например, у объекта Workbook есть метод Close, закрывающий книгу, и свойство ActiveSheet, представляющее лист, активный в данный момент в книге. excel excel vba vba. Как активировать книгу, открытую с использованием имени книги в VBA.Когда я пытаюсь это сделать, он дает мне ошибку «Subscript out the range». Как это решить?Excel VBA - текст из текстового поля в активной ячейке. По умолчанию Excel отображает каждое изменение в рабочей книге, сделанное в ходе выполненияVBA-кода.Это приводит кПрофессиональная работа с VBA. сится к рабочему листу или диаграмме, активной в текущий момент (безусловно, в книге, активной сейчас). ActiveWorkbook.Name - имя активной книги ThisWorkbook.Name - имя книги, где находится макрос, независимо от того, какая книга активна. Если вы хотите сделать найденную книгу активной, то вызовите метод Activate.Например, установленный "Kaspersky Office Guard", входящий в состав "Антивирус Касперского", начисто отключает все вызовы VBA. Всем привет! MS сделать выпадающий календарь при выборе ячейки мышкой? VBA У меня более 30 вкладок одной книге, часть ячеек не должна копировать другую книгу, они перевода фио дательный падеж (для использования ячейках листа excel) обратиться к диапазону из vba.

VBA в Excel Application Workbooks Workbook Sheets Charts Chart Worksheets Worksheet Range.

Каждая рабочая книга представлена объектом Workbook. Узнать сколько рабочих книг сейчас в коллекции можно такСделаем активной ячейку A2:A2 Чтобы скопировать или переместить листы в пределах книги или между книгами, можно использовать Microsoft Visual Basic для приложений (VBA) кода. Это особенно полезно, если требуется переместить или скопировать много листов или если вы хотите сделать несколько Ещё один способ — завести переменную, скажем, ИмяКниги и в момент, когда Вы точно знаете, что нужная книга активна, прописать [vba]. Код. Как сделать лист другой книги - скрытым - VBA.Сохранить книгу в формате csv - VBA. Товарищи, помогите разобраться. Хочу настроить макрос таким образом, чтобы активная книга сохранялась в формате .csv (разделитель - запятая). Можно ли из программы на Visual Basic создать рабочую книгу Excel ?A: Сделать можно вот как: (Пример реализации на Excel97 VBA ). Function IsWorkSheetExist Проверяет, имеется ли в активной рабочей книге лист с именем sSName. Если редактор Visual Basic открыт из Excel, то в Project Explorer будут открытые книги Excel иОчень часто в VBA требуется сделать какое-нибудь действие со всеми эле-ментамиДалее бу-дет рассказано про большинство активно используемых функций языка VBA Дата и время. Работа с текстом. Макросы VBA. Пользовательская функция. Настройки.переходим в активную книгу откуда необходимо скопировать данные abook.WorksheetsВопрос. Как сделать всё тоже самое, но чтобы переносилось в другой файл. Системное и прикладное программирование. MS Office и VB(A). Переход между книгами при активной UserForm VBA.Если бы это сделать как с установкой/снятием паролей одновременно на все листы сколько бы их там не было который я использую. Можно ли из программы на Visual Basic создать рабочую книгу Excel?A: Сделать можно вот как: (Пример реализации на Excelв97 VBA ).

" Function IsWorkSheetExist " Проверяет, имеется ли в активной рабочей книге лист с именем sSName. А проблема в следующем, после обработки кода проекта VBA в книге Excel (программа обработчик на VB6) иВручную сделать ее отображаемой можно через Окно > Отобразить и выбора соответствующей книги. 09.07.2006. Как после открытия определённой книги, сделать так, чтобы имя нужного рабочего листа текущей дате ? 29.03.2011.Как скрыть активный лист средствами VBA ? 2004. Как определить номер (индекс) листа ? Visual Basic for Applications (в дальнейшем просто VBA) — это объектно-ориентированный язык программирования, специальноАктивное окно. ActiveWorkbook. Активная рабочая книга. ScreenUpdating. Режим обновления экрана (при выполнении процедуры для ускорения работы Vba сделать книгу активной. Тогда можешь прямо ссылаться на него из VBAЗакрываем Excel, в котором была создана Книга1. Excel vba сделать книгу активной. Появится редактор VBA введите код, как на рисунке ниже При открытии книги Excel выполняется автозапуск приложения VBA, которое открывается поверх окна Excel.Делаем нашу книгу Excel таблицы невидимой, а при закрытии программы нужно закрывать и Excel. Как это сделать? Глава 3. Основы программирования на VBA Вызов редактора Visual Basic.Ниже, в разделе "Подробнее о том, что можно сделать в VBA", эти возможности обсуждаются более детально.В диалоговом окне Макрос макросы из активной рабочей книги приво-дятся под своими Пример того, как из Visual Basica через OLE запустить Excel, и создать рабочую книгуMichael Zemlaynukha, (2:5015/4.9FidoNet, ) - за полезные замечания и здоровую критику этого FAQа. Фото Как в vba сделать активным лист. Можно ли из программы на Visual Basic создать рабочую книгу Excel?A: Сделать можно вот как: (Пример реализации на Excel97 VBA ). Function IsWorkSheetExist Проверяет, имеется ли в активной рабочей книге лист с именем sSName. Язык VBA в основном совпадает с Visual Basic for Windows, но имеет и существенные отличия.Если true, то со времени последнего сохране-ния никаких изменений в книге не сделаноS Application.ActiveWorkbook.Name Отобразить путь активной книги Next в VBA и рассмотрим на примерах, каким образом можно получить кол-во открытых книг Excel, имена этих книг, а так же кол-во и имена страниц активной книги. Другими словами, не существует автоматического способа сделать так, чтобы все листы имели одинаковые выделенныеМакрос VBA, показанный ниже, берет за основу активный рабочий лист и выполняет следующие действия со всеми остальными рабочими листами в книге Глава 3. основные объекты VBA. Содержание. Команды для работы с объектами.ActiveSheet Возвращает активный лист книги. Для получения имени листа используется свойство Name объекта Sheet. Добрый день! Подскажите, пожалуйста, как после использование метода Workbooks.Add сделать так, чтобы созданная книга стала активной (отображалась поверх остальных окон). Заранее благодарен. Здравствуйте! Я подобрал для вас темы с ответами на вопрос Как сделать книгу активной, зная имя книги?VBA может узнать имя неактивной открытой книги и сделать её активной? Создание приложения на vba путем написания процедур и функций стоит называть процедурным клавиш.Макрос для получения списка файлов, поиск файлов папке подпапках, список Excel глава 2. Николай, а как сделать макрос, чтоб выбранном диапазоне данные округлялись по 11.4 Коллекция Workbooks и объект Workbook, их свойства и методы. Объект Excel.Workbook, программная работа с книгами Excel из VBA, создание и открытие книг Excel. Следующий по иерархии после Application объект в объектной модели Excel — это объект Workbook Что визуального в Visual Basic для приложений? К счастью, VBA во многом избавляет от необходимости нудного печатания программного кода.Рассмотрим для примера Excel, где вы можете выполнять как программы, хранящиеся в активной рабочей книге (т.е. той. которую вы Visual Basic.Создать новую рабочую книгу - VBA Создайте новую процедуру УпрЛабРаб9, которая должнаПример реализации макроса на VBA Excel по формированию документов на основе шаблона.Создаем новую книгу или делаем ее активной If NewBook "" Then. Активируйте редактор Visual Basic, нажав ALT F11. Щелкните правой кнопкой мыши в окне проекта. Выберите InsertModule.Как и в рабочих книгах, каждый раз, когда вы добавляете новый лист с помощью VBA, он автоматически становится активным. А как сделать так, что если файл существует, окно не появлялось и файл заменялся автоматически? Цитата(Akina 27.1.2010, 09:38).False (default) saves files against the language of Visual Basic for Applications (VBA) (which is typically US English unless the VBA project where 1 Теоретические сведения. Язык VBA разработан преимущественно для работы с приложениями и для расширения их возможностей.- ActiveWorkbook возвращает активную (текущую) книгу - ActiveSheet возвращает активный лист в активной рабочей книге. Microsoft Visual Basic for Applications (VBA) — чрезвычайно мощный языкПредназначение следующей функции заключается в выводе имени файла активной рабочей книги в ячейке, какЧтобы создать сводную таблицу с помощью VBA в Excel 2000 и более позд них версиях Такое заключение можно сделать даже на примере, рассмотренном в предыдущей главе.Например, worksheets (1) обозначает первый рабочий лист активной книги, a worksheetsДля создания диалоговых окон, разрабатываемых приложений в VBA, используются формы. Книга остается в панели задач, а активным остается окно 1С откуда этот код и вызывался.ну допустим нужно не просто открыть файл, но что-либо там сделать, оформить, макрос запустить - т.е. нужен именно СОМ. Сослаться на активный объект Workbook или Sheet в коде VBA можно как на ActiveWorkbook или ActiveSheet, а на активный объект Range как на Selection.Смена активного объекта. Если в процессе выполнения программы требуется сделать активной другую рабочую книгу, другой Форум » Excel » Excel Макросы (VBA) » Как определить имя активной книги ( VBA excel).Главная страница форума Windows Microsoft Windows 7 Microsoft Windows 8 Excel Excel Макросы ( VBA) Excel 2003 Excel 2007 Excel 2010 Аналитика Управление финансами Веб-мастеру Работа Создание новой книги. Новая книга в VBA Excel создается с помощью выраженияОбращение к открытым книгам. Обращение к активной книге: ActiveWorkbook. Все форумы / Visual Basic. Как сделать активным лист в нетекущей книге? [new].То есть в переменной NewBook у тебя будет жить ссылка на другую книгу и через нее ты можешь делать с ней все, что угодно, например поставить автофильтр По умолчанию Excel отображает каждое изменение в рабочей книге, сделанное в ходе выполнения VBA-кода.Например, свойство ActiveSheet объекта Application относится к рабочему листу или диаграмме, активной в текущий момент (безусловно, в книге, активной Да я все понял Серёжа. Лист делаешь видимым,сохраняешь как книгу и отправляешь.Это само собой подразумевается.Я бы так делал.Отправку надо сделать в фоновом режиме, чтобы не мешала основной работе. Vlastn funkce, inteligentn makra Kurz programovn VBA - Praha, Brno.Сонник маникюр на руках делают Как сделать настойку василька в домашних условиях Как сделать свой бизнес более эффективным Спальня 9 кв м дизайн с мебелью Септик своими руками без откачки Требуется открыть определённую книгу Excel из VBA Access, а если она открыта сделать её окно активным.Если же нужная книга уже открыта, но окно её неактивно, активировать окно средствами VBA мне никак не удаётся.

Схожие по теме записи:


Добавить комментарий

Ваш e-mail не будет опубликован. Обязательные поля помечены *

*

*